Bottle from Kisjes Slijterijen, Meppel. Aroma is dark malt, smoke, caramel, mild peat with a touch of roast and a slight hint of cocoa. Flavour is moderate to medium sweet and bitter. Body is anove medium. A very fine smoked peated Doppelbock.

Bottle @ home. Dark red brown color with a dark red glare coming through, average sized off-white head. Aroma is malts, brown malts, lightly smoky. Taste malts, brown malts, smoke, brown malt bitter. Decent to medium body and carbonation. Not bad actually. Quite pleasant.

Tap at DBs. Dark clear brown with big light brown head. Some cocoa, toffee, dead leaves, dried figs and raisins, light wood, some roasted nuts and bitter old dusty herbs. Medium sweet with lasting bitter finish. Over medium bodied.
